- Tom Vater went to the PA West Presidents Meeting. Items
discussed were the registration only being for one year and
that there would be two types of player cards. Tom noted
that we were not getting things in a timely manner until
late July which is a problem for us. Player’s cards are good
for this year and PA West is charging $6 for each Travel
team that uses there Web Site. After the meeting there was
discussion of another league being created. Discussion
followed and we are going to continue to be part of PA West.

Registration -
- Don Snyder reported that there were 192 players
registered for travel and 425 players registered for
flights. Fight 1 has 91 players, Flight 2 has 90 players,
Flight 3 has 74 players, Flight 4 has 68 players, Flight 5
Girls has 68 players and Flight 5 Boys has 34 players.
- Flight registration is continuing until further notice
due to low registration. Jim Huber will take deadline off
Web Site.
